Which way does the moon revolve around the earth? B. Phases of the Moon Definitions: The following terms define the various phases of the moon. Memorize these terms! Full Moon The moon is full when the side we see is 100% illuminated. A full moon looks like a perfect circle. New Moon The moon is new when the side we see is dark. We cannot see a new moon at all. Crescent Moon A crescent moon is shaped like a crescent; a smaller proportion of the moon is illuminated than is the case during a quarter moon. Quarter Moon The moon is called a quarter moon when it looks like a half circle Gibbous Moon A gibbous moon is shaped like a lopsided football; a larger proportion of the moon is illuminated than is the case during a quarter moon. Waxing Moon The moon is waxing when the illuminated portion of the moon is getting a little bit bigger every day. Waning Moon The moon is waning when the illuminated portion of the moon is getting a little bit smaller every day. 1.
